## Handling calendar sync conflicts

When your plugin writes an event that Tidewell Calendar has modified since your last sync, the Meridian sync engine returns a conflict response rather than overwriting either copy. Plugin authors should fetch the latest revision, merge changes, and resubmit with the updated revision token. To test conflict behavior, use the sandbox conflict-simulator endpoint, which requires authentication against our internal plugin gateway. Use the sandbox key provided below for all conflict-simulation requests.

service key, fawip-bajef: kto11_Qt5wZK9vdNC

Currency conversion in Fenmarrow rounds at the ledger layer, not at display. If totals drift by a cent, check the half-even rounding config first; do not patch the UI. Known hotspot: batch invoices crossing three currencies. Rollback is safe; reconversion is not. Escalate persistent drift over one cent per line item to the payments desk here.

alerts address for kagaf-yawig: sorwyn_eliath@qorvelworks.internal

## Deployment: Hot-Reloading Config

Good news: Marblewick now watches its config file, so most tweaks don't need a restart. Save the file, wait about five seconds, and the new values kick in. Heads up for release day: anything under the `listener` section still requires a full bounce, so plan those changes for the maintenance window. Everything else — timeouts, log levels, feature flags — reloads live. These are the values that hot-reload cleanly in production today.

service settings:
[casax]
port = 6379
team = rusir
host = casax.zemvarhq.corp
region = outer-4
access_code = ac_9808ce
timeout_ms = 1500